Subject: Handover — Meshway gateway duty

Taking over Meshway release duty? Quick notes: rate limits are per-tenant, enforced at the gateway tier. Bursts over 200 rps trip the shaper; don't raise limits without capacity review. Config changes deploy via the usual pipeline and must be signed. The deploy key you'll need for pushing gateway configs is below.

signing key of bagap-yawep = bky13_TbfT6ZMUoGJo2

# Break-Glass: Catalog Cache Invalidation

Scope: the Pinrow product catalog at Veldstone Retail. If stale prices persist after a purge and the Hollowmere invalidation queue is wedged, use break-glass to flush the edge tier directly. Contractors: get verbal sign-off from the catalog lead first. Steps: open the Hollowmere admin shell, select emergency-flush, confirm the tenant, and run it once — repeated flushes thrash the origin. Access is logged and expires after 20 minutes. Unseal the admin shell with the passphrase below.

recovery phrase for kahop-tajog: istix-casvan

## 0.9.2 — Setting renamed

Renamed SOLVER_LOCK_KEY to TIMETABLE_SOLVER_TOKEN in Gridbell, our school timetable solver. Old name removed; no fallback. Update every .env before deploying, or the constraint worker refuses to claim jobs. Migration is one line; nothing else changed in this release. The token itself is issued per environment by the Gridbell admin panel. Add the following line to your .env:

sealed setting: COURIER_KEY29=170ad45524657711572101e080d15